From the Desk of Father Raaser

On the cover of the bulletin are the names of the 62nd Graduating Class from St. Margaret’s School. We congratulate the students and thank their families for sending them to Catholic School. It takes a great deal of sacrifice to send your children to a Catholic school. I need not tell you how expensive it is to live in Pearl River, with all the taxes especially the school tax. Certainly, it is the choice of the parents who decide to sacrifice much to send their children to Catholic school. I believe certainly and then some, it is well worth the sacrifice.

All except one will be attending Catholic High School, and combined they received over $350,000 in scholarships. The Class of 2018, now proud alumni of the School, are a wonderful group of kids. All the teachers said the same thing, that they will be missed. I know they were given the right foundation for their life at St. Margaret’s. We look forward to hearing great things about them.

I also congratulate all our young parishioners who had been graduated from Pearl River High School this past Wednesday evening, as well as, all the other schools. School’s out for summer!

We are grateful to God for summertime and may we not forget God amidst the joys of summer and to get to Mass every Sunday. There’s a in every vacation town, just how hard will you look for it?

RENEW AND REBUILD

To keep you informed about our progress with the school boiler. The size of the original boiler was almost 3 times the size needed! I guess the Sisters and students wanted to make sure they were kept warm!! So, the first good news is that we don’t need that large size boiler, which will certainly free up a lot of room in the boiler room. We are looking at purchasing two smaller, efficient boilers, with zone heating. We are now going out to bid for the purchase of the boilers and the plumbing that will be needed. Once we have the new system, we will then begin the demolition of the old boiler. It will, hopefully, take place this summer.

A great deal of gratitude to Kevin Stokes and his talented workers, our drainage problem has been solved in the front plaza. New pipes were fitted properly and put down, pitched correctly, gravel and cement work, and pavers replaced. Please God; there will be no more cave-ins in the front plaza.
